The continuity of action helps us to obtain rounder curves - SKIING S.2. EP.2

Let's try together with Valerio Malfatto by Jam Session to give Ana a piece of advice to help Sciare Meglio. The keyword for Ana will be linked to the continuity of action during skiing, which helps us to get rounder curves.

ANALYSIS Ana has great potential, she is a born attacker and with some right exercises she can make great progress. Reducing the speed a little and trying to give roundness to the curve and progression to the action can refine the technique and go back to apply it in speed. OBJECTIVE Continuity to its action and make very rounded curves, trying with both feet to give direction and strength progressive to the skis in function of a round curve. EXERCISE AND IDEAS GUIDANon to be in a hurry to move from one curve to another and keep the outside for a long time while exercising a growing force. Try to count: one, two, three, four , five, you are giving progression of strength and feeling the feet that want to round the curve until the ski goes up the slope with the load always on the outside.Then try to speed increasing
